Viola Stavole's Obituary
Viola V. Stavole (nee Campbell), age 77, a resident of Amherst for the past 33 years, passed away Thursday, September 23, 2010 at The Renaissance Hospice Care Center in Olmsted Twp.
Viola was born on October 31, 1932 in Nashville, Ohio to the late Forest and Esther (nee Spencer) Campbell. She graduated from Lakeville High School, Lakeville, Ohio in 1950. After high school graduation she attended the College of Wooster Conservatory of Music for a year transferring to Ashland University where she received her Bachelor’s Degree in Education and went on to receive her Master’s Degree in Education from Kent State University.
She was employed by the Berea City Schools and the Lorain City Schools. She retired in 1994 from the Lorain City Schools after 34 years of service. Viola was an accomplished pianist and violinist. She enjoyed reading, traveling and music.
Viola is survived by her husband of 46 years, Michael; sons, Joseph of Amherst Twp., and Jonathan of Minneapolis, MN; a daughter, Jill (Shane) Karnes of Marysville, Ohio; grandchildren, Jarrett, Tristan and Riley Karnes; brother, Vaughn (Elaine) Campbell of Amherst; sister, Vivian (Alex) Nagy of Ashland.
